Title :
Design and analysis of Toeplitz preconditioners

Abstract :
A general approach is presented for constructing preconditioners P for a symmetric positive-definite Toeplitz matrix A so that the Toeplitz system Ax=b can be solved efficiently by the preconditioned conjugate-gradient (PCG) method. The work is a generalization of recent work by G. Strang (1986) and R. Chan (1988). It is shown that the new preconditioners can be inverted directly by means of various fast transform methods with O(N log N) operations and that the eigenvalues of the preconditioned matrices P-1 A are clustered around one so that the PCG method converges very quickly
